Optimal raised bed depth for potatoes: soil science breakdown
When growing potatoes in raised beds, the depth of your soil directly impacts tuber development and overall yield. Unlike in-ground planting, raised beds offer precise control over soil depth, but choosing the wrong dimensions can lead to stunted roots or wasted space.
The sweet spot for most potato varieties is a 12- to 18-inch soil depth, but why? Let’s break down the science behind this recommendation and how to tailor it to your specific growing conditions.
Potatoes are deep-rooted crops, with tubers forming along underground stems called stolons. These stolons need ample space to grow and develop into market-size potatoes.
In a 12-inch raised bed, you’ll get decent yields of smaller potatoes, but the real growth potential unlocks when you hit 18 inches. This extra depth allows for larger tubers and better storage capacity for late-season harvests.
However, not all varieties require the same depth, and soil type plays a critical role in determining the ideal dimensions.
Soil science tells us that potatoes thrive in loose, well-aerated soil with good drainage. In clay-heavy soils, deeper beds help prevent waterlogging, while sandy soils benefit from extra depth to retain moisture and nutrients. The root zone for potatoes extends beyond the tubers themselves, so deeper beds also support stronger foliage growth, which translates to healthier plants and bigger harvests.

For standard potato varieties like Russet or Yukon Gold, an 18-inch raised bed is ideal because it accommodates their deeper root systems and larger tubers. These varieties can produce potatoes that weigh 1 pound or more each, but only if given enough space.
In contrast, dwarf varieties like Red Pontiac thrive in 10- to 12-inch beds, as their tubers stay smaller and compact. If you’re growing early-maturing varieties, a 12- to 14-inch bed often suffices, as they prioritize speed over size.
Adjusting for soil type is crucial. In clay-heavy soils, aim for 18+ inches to prevent waterlogging, which can rot tubers and stunt growth. Add coarse sand or perlite to improve drainage if your bed isn’t deep enough.
Conversely, sandy soils benefit from 14- to 16-inch beds layered with compost or peat moss to retain moisture and nutrients. Sandy soil drains too quickly, so deeper beds help store water for those hot, dry spells.

How to build a potato-friendly raised bed: layering secrets for best results
Building a raised bed for potatoes isn't just about digging a hole—it's about creating a nutrient-rich, well-draining ecosystem where tubers can thrive. The key lies in layering materials strategically to mimic ideal growing conditions.
I’ve learned that a 12-18 inch depth is non-negotiable for most varieties, but the real magic happens in how you stack your layers for drainage, aeration, and moisture retention.
First, choose durable, rot-resistant materials like cedar or untreated lumber for your bed frame. Avoid pressure-treated wood with high arsenic levels—opt for eco-friendly alternatives like composite lumber or recycled plastic.
My 4x8-foot bed uses cedar planks because they resist moisture and last years without warping. Place the bed on landscape fabric to block weeds while allowing water to seep through.
Now, let’s talk layers—the secret sauce for potato success. Start with a 4-inch base layer of coarse material like gravel or broken bricks. This isn’t just for looks; it’s your drainage foundation to prevent waterlogging, which can rot tubers.
Next, add 6 inches of carbon-rich material like straw or shredded leaves to balance your soil’s nitrogen levels.
Step-by-Step Raised Bed Construction for Potatoes
- 1 Base Layer: Add 4 inches of gravel or broken bricks at the bottom for drainage. This prevents water from pooling and rotting tubers.
- 2 Carbon Layer: Layer 6 inches of straw or shredded leaves to balance nitrogen levels and improve soil structure.
- 3 Compost Mix: Fill the remaining 8-12 inches with a blend of 50% compost, 30% garden soil, and 20% perlite for aeration.
- 4 Planting: Place seed potatoes 4 inches deep and 12 inches apart. Cover with 2-3 inches of soil and water deeply.
- 5 Mulch: Top with 2 inches of straw mulch to retain moisture and suppress weeds. Replenish as needed.
After your base and carbon layers, fill the remaining 8-12 inches with a custom soil mix of 50% compost, 30% garden soil, and 20% perlite. This blend ensures optimal aeration while retaining moisture—critical for potato growth.
Avoid heavy garden soil, which compacts easily and stunts tuber development. I always test my mix by squeezing a handful; it should hold shape but crumble easily.
Avoid these common mistakes that sabotage potato beds: using fresh manure (it burns roots), skipping the drainage layer (leads to rot), or over-filling with sandy soil (dries out too quickly).
My first bed failed because I ignored the gravel base—now I double-check drainage before planting. Also, rotate crops annually to prevent disease buildup in the soil.
Finally, water deeply but infrequently—potatoes hate soggy feet. Aim for 1-2 inches of water weekly, delivered in the morning to reduce fungal risks. As your plants grow, hill soil around stems to encourage more tuber formation.
